Drainage sloping services involve adjusting the grade or slope of a property's landscape to ensure proper water runoff. This process typically includes grading the land to direct excess water away from foundations, basements, and other vulnerable areas. Proper drainage slopes help prevent water from pooling on the surface or infiltrating the soil near structures, reducing the risk of water-related damage. Skilled professionals assess the existing terrain and design a slope that facilitates efficient water flow, often using specialized equipment to reshape the landscape as needed.
These services address common problems associated with poor drainage, such as water pooling, soil erosion, and foundation issues. When water does not drain properly, it can lead to basement flooding, cracks in the foundation, and damage to landscaping or walkways. Over time, standing water can also promote mold growth and attract pests. By creating effective drainage slopes, property owners can mitigate these risks, maintaining the integrity of their structures and the safety of outdoor spaces.

Drainage Sloping Services Cost - Typical costs for drainage sloping services range from $300 to $1,200, depending on the size of the area and complexity of the slope. For example, a small residential yard may cost around $350, while larger properties could be closer to $1,000 or more.
Labor and Material Expenses - Labor costs generally fall between $50 and $100 per hour, with materials such as gravel or soil averaging $20 to $50 per cubic yard. Total costs depend on the project's scope and the required materials.
Project Size and Complexity - Smaller drainage adjustments might cost under $500, while extensive grading and slope corrections can range up to $2,000 or higher. Factors influencing price include existing terrain and drainage system requirements.
Additional Service Charges - Extra costs may include permits or debris removal, which can add $100 to $300 to the overall price. Contact local pros for detailed estimates tailored to specific drainage needs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
